knrt.net
当前位置:首页 >> AngulAr怎么给option绑定事件 >>

AngulAr怎么给option绑定事件

jquery写法 选项1 选项2 选项3$("#myselect").change(function(){ var opt=$("#myselect").val(); });

1 . 我们知道在jquery中,动态生成一个元素,如果要在动态生成元素的同时,动态绑定事件,可以通过live/on方法(在jquery3.0中已经废除了bind方法). 2 . 在angularjs中,操作DOM一般在指令中完成,事件监听机制是在对于已经静态生成的

angularjs给div添加点击事件是通过ng-click来实现的.写法:在$scope范围内定义的函数可以直接引用.1、完整的html代码:{{course.Name}}2、增加事件的OpenCourse方法:$scope.OpenCourse = function(courseId) {$window.alert("Called " + courseId);}

ng-model赋值option里的第一个值就可以默认选中第一个了

1、因为要生成不确定数量和内容的html元素,所以需要一个(双向绑定的)集合来保存它们;2、同时需要一个对象来保存目前正在创建的项,还需要一个方法用于把这个项保存到集合里然后重置它;3、当然也可以不需要一个对象,而是捕获添加时input的值,但这不是angular的写法,这是jquery的写法.

1、因为要生成不确定数量和内容的HTML元素,所以需要一个(双向绑定的)集合来保存它们;2、同时需要一个对象来保存目前正在创建的项,还需要一个方法用于把这个项保存到集合里然后重置它;3、当然也可以不需要一个对象,而是捕获添加时input的值,但这不是angular的写法,这是jQuery的写法.

可以的,但是select option应该是change事件吧:$("#productvar").bind("change",function(){..}):

AngularJS实现给动态生成的元素绑定事件 工具 : AngularJS 思路及解决步奏 :

addClass()-为每个匹配的元素添加指定的样式类名after()-在匹配元素集合中的每个元素后面插入参数所指定的内容,作为其兄弟节点append()-在每个匹配元素里面的末尾处插入参数内容attr() - 获取匹配的元素集合中的第一个元素的

在angular中,默认不支持事件代理,但是在处理大量数据的时候,尤其是一些列表的时候,事件代理是必须的,那应该怎么样实现这个代理呢,并且用起来很方便呢,此处实现一个,有参考nishp1的angular-delegate-event实现;增加了对象式

相关文档
网站首页 | 网站地图
All rights reserved Powered by www.knrt.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com